DECLARATION OF SNOW EMERGENCY.
In accordance State Statute 166.03(4) and with Village Ordinance, the Village of Bellevue, hereby declares a snow emergency. During such period of declared snow removal emergency, no person shall cause nor allow the parking or standing of any vehicle, trailer, or semitrailer, except emergency vehicles, upon any Village Street until after the period of declaration has come to an end. The Sheriff’s Department may tow away any motor vehicle, trailer, or semitrailer found in violation of this declaration at the owner’s expense.
Said declaration shall take effect at 12:00 p.m. on Wednesday, February 22, 2023 and remain in effect until 12:00 p.m. on Friday, February 24, 2023.
During Bellevue’s snow emergency period, the following restrictions apply:
1) No vehicle can park on any street until the snow emergency has expired
2) Overnight on-street parking will not be granted
3) Vehicles found parking on-street during the snow emergency will be tagged, ticketed and towed at the owner’s expense
Again, the snow emergency will remain in effect until 12:00 p.m. on Friday. All Village of Bellevue residents and property owners must follow these snow emergency restrictions so they don’t receive citations and the Village can clear roads in a safe and efficient manner.
